sql server 两年前
时间: 2023-09-12 12:06:23 浏览: 40
在两年前,SQL Server是一种广泛使用的关系型数据库管理系统。它由微软开发,用于存储和管理结构化数据。SQL Server具有强大的功能和工具,可用于各种应用程序和业务需求。在两年前,可能是SQL Server 2019或SQL Server 2017版本。它提供了许多功能,包括高性能、安全性、可扩展性和可靠性。通过SQL Server,您可以执行各种数据库操作,例如创建表、插入数据、查询数据和更新数据等。
相关问题
DATEDIFF sqlserver
DATEDIFF函数是SQL Server中的一个日期函数,用于计算两个日期之间的差异。该函数接受三个参数:日期部分、开始日期和结束日期。日期部分可以是年、季度、月、周、日等。通过DATEDIFF函数,可以计算出两个日期之间的差异值。
在你提供的引用中,引用展示了如何使用DATEDIFF函数来计算两个日期之间的天数差异。在这个例子中,DATEDIFF使用了日期部分为'dd',表示计算天数。开始日期为'2019-03-17 15:09:10.797',结束日期为'2019-04-17 15:09:10.797',计算结果为31,表示这两个日期之间相差31天。
同时,引用展示了如何使用DATEDIFF函数来计算两个日期之间的星期差异。在这个例子中,DATEDIFF使用了日期部分为'w',表示计算星期数。开始日期为'2019-04-01 15:09:10.797',结束日期为'2019-04-17 15:09:10.797',计算结果为16,表示这两个日期之间相差16个星期。
sql server yyyymm
根据引用和引用中的信息,我可以告诉你,在SQL Server中,要获取到形如"yyyymm"格式的日期,可以使用以下方法:
1. 获取当前日期的yyyymm格式:
```
SELECT FORMAT(GETDATE(), 'yyyyMM')
```
这将返回当前日期的年份和月份合并的结果,例如"202108"表示2021年8月。
2. 获取指定日期的yyyymm格式:
假设你有一个日期字段为`date_column`,你可以使用以下语句来获得该字段的yyyymm格式:
```
SELECT FORMAT(date_column, 'yyyyMM') FROM your_table
```
这将返回该日期字段的年份和月份合并的结果。
请注意,以上两个示例中使用的`FORMAT`函数是SQL Server 2012及更高版本引入的函数,如果你的SQL Server版本较低,则需要使用其他方法来实现相同的效果。